The decentralized finance platform offers its users up to 80% annual returns incentivizing the majority of users to join decentralized finance.
GEORGE TOWN, Cayman Islands - CuisineWire -- Kaizen Finance, a decentralized finance platform with cross-blockchain interoperable protocol, announces the launch of Kaizen staking.
Kaizen staking is based on Kaizen protocol, a new generation DeFi protocol, which addresses major impediments to accessing DeFi services such as impermanent loss, hidden fees and high transaction costs which prevent DeFi from being inclusive of millions of users.
To promote DeFi adoption, Kaizen Finance currently offers up to 80% APY for major stablecoins like USDT, BUSD, USDC and DAI with a minimal lockup period of 6 months within its staking service. Kaizen Finance does not charge users any fees for staking their income.

Kaizen staking operates on the basis of stablecoin to provide asset security. The value of stablecoins is pegged to USD, providing minimal risks of volatility and reducing risks of losing asset value. Kaizen staking leverages the full security potential of decentralized finance, therefore the rewards are generated and transferred automatically and no entity can meddle with them.
Kaizen Finance launched the Kaizen swapping service earlier this year introducing the ability to swap USDT and ETH for tokens of pioneering products and services.
